计算机软件工程B(共5页).doc
《计算机软件工程B(共5页).doc》由会员分享,可在线阅读,更多相关《计算机软件工程B(共5页).doc(5页珍藏版)》请在得力文库 - 分享文档赚钱的网站上搜索。
1、精选优质文档-倾情为你奉上地市_ 姓名_ 学号_密封线曲阜师范大学成人教育二0一0级计算机专业(本科)2011年下半年第四学期软件工程 (B卷)注意事项:1、本试卷共8页,满分100分,考试时间为120分钟。 2、答卷前将密封线内的项目填写清楚。题 号一二三四总 分得 分得 分一、选择题(在每小题的四个备选答案中,选出正确的,并将选项序号填在题干中括号内,每小题2分,共40分)评卷人1、软件生存周期中时间最长的是( D )阶段。A、总体设计 B、需求分析 C、软件测试 D、软件维护 2、软件工程管理对软件项目的开发管理,即对整个软件( C )的一切活动的管理。A、软件项目 B、生存期 C、软件
2、开发计划 D、软件开发 3、与设计测试数据无关的文档是(D)。A、需求说明书 B、数据说明书 C、源程序 D、项目开发设计4、软件需求分析的主要任务是准确定义所开发的软件系统是 ( C )。A、如何做B、怎么做 C、做什么D、对谁做5、结构化分析的方法是一种 ( D )。A、系统分析方法 B、面向数据结构的分析方法C、面向对象的分析方法D、面向数据流的分析方法6、以下哪个软件生存周期模型是一种风险驱动的模型(C)。A、瀑布模型 B、增量模型 C、螺旋模型 D、喷泉模型软件工程试卷 第1页(共8页)7、在软件的设计阶段应提供的文档是(B )。A、软件需求规格说明书 B、概要设计规格说明书和详细设
3、计规格说明书C、数据字典及流程图 D、源程序以及源程序的说明书8、划分软件生存周期的阶段时所应遵循的基本原则是(B )。A、各阶段的任务尽可能相关性 B、各阶段的任务尽可能相对独立C、各阶段的任务在时间上连续 D、各阶段的任务在时间上相对独立9、系统定义明确之后,应对系统的可行性进行研究。可行性研究应包括(B )。A、软件环境可行性、技术可行性、经济可行性、社会可行性B、经济可行性、技术可行性、操作可行性C、经济可行性、社会可行性、系统可行性D、经济可行性、实用性、社会可行性10、面向数据结构的设计方法(Jackson方法)是进行( B )的形式化的方法。A、系统设计 B、详细设计 C、软件设
4、计 D、编码11、在进行软件测试时, 首先应当进行( A ),然后再进行组装测试,最后再进行有效性测试。A、单元测试 B、集成测试 C、确认测试 D、组合测试12、在整个软件维护阶段所花费的全部工作中,( B )所占比例最大。A、校正性维护 B、适应性维护 C、完善性维护 D、预防性维护13、结构化设计是一种应用最广泛的系统设计方法,是以(B)为基础,自顶向下,求精和模块化的过程。A、数据流 B、数据流图 C、数据库 D、数据结构14、下列( B )不是反映用户在使用软件产品时的三种倾向。A、产品运行 B、产品可再用性 C、产品修改 D、产品转移软件工程试卷 第2页(共8页)15、在对数据流的
5、分析中,主要是找到变换中心,这是从( C )导出结构图的关键。A、数据结构 B、实体关系 C、数据流图 D、ER图16、以下哪一项不是软件危机的表现(C)。A、开发的软件可维护性差 B、软件极易被盗版C、经费预算经常被突破 D、开发的软件不能满足用户需求 17、以下哪一项对模块耦合性没有影响(D)。A、模块间接口的复杂程度 B、调用模块的方式C、通过接口的信息 D、模块内部各个元素彼此之间的紧密结合程度18、检查软件产品是否符合需求定义的过程称为(A)。A、确认测试 B、集成测试 C、系统测试 D、单元测试19、下面关于详细设计的叙述中,错误的是(B)。A、程序流程图可以描述结构化程序 B、程
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 计算机软件 工程
限制150内